Output 44e6c66b7fa95b5151f6f6e02f3eb08c70cb27fa222650d1da2f24d7a020addc:33

value
1115700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 595394fa2ec281624e55b9d83a9f5ad4553bdbb0 OP_EQUAL
address
39qLBzUnazjCVyZq623k2zgWCzL65VhGfy
transaction
44e6c66b7fa95b5151f6f6e02f3eb08c70cb27fa222650d1da2f24d7a020addc
confirmations
217749
spent
true